Tecno has started to tease its new smartphone from the Pova series, suggesting an eye-catching design that might change the brand’s look. Although the precise name of the device is still not clear, early previews indicate a daring new path for this series.
Exciting New Pova Series Ahead
The teaser visuals showcase a phone with a unique triangular camera module on its backside, which includes LED lighting for a modern flair. Tecno hasn’t revealed the official name yet, but due to its design shift, it’s believed to be part of the Pova 7 series. The device is anticipated to have a triple-camera system. The teaser also points out a square frame with smooth edges, providing an easy hold. However, specifics about the front design and internal features are still unknown at this point.
Reflection on the Pova 6 Series
The Pova 6 series from Tecno brought in notable design improvements, with the Pova 6 Pro featuring the Arc Interface, along with an RGB LED lighting setup that boosted its appeal for gamers. This series also offered solid hardware, such as high refresh-rate screens and big batteries, making it a great choice for those who prioritize performance. The Pova 6 lineup illustrated Tecno’s aim to merge gaming looks with everyday functionality. The series featured several models, including Pova 6, Pova 6 Neo, Pova 6 Neo 5G, and Pova 6 Pro, but it seems the Pova 7 series won’t include a “Neo” variant.
Upcoming Pova 7 Series Models
The Pova 7 series is likely to have several models designed for different markets. These will include the Pova 7 (model number LJ6), Pova 7 5G (LJ7), Pova 7 Pro 5G (LJ8), Pova 7 Curve 5G (LJ8k), and Pova 7 Pro+ 5G (LJ9). Even though Tecno hasn’t officially confirmed the entire lineup, these model numbers suggest a wide variety of options.
As teasers continue to be released, more information about the forthcoming Pova smartphone, including its features and release schedule, should be arriving soon. It’s likely that the new Pova 7 series could launch in India within the next few days.
